Brief summary

The main objective of the study is to evaluate the effectiveness of a lifestyle program for women with Polycystic Ovary Syndrome (PCOS). The investigators want to assess the efficacy of a pulse-based diet (i.e. a diet that contains lentils, chick-peas, and beans) on the clinical features, biochemical, and hormonal parameters of PCOS compared to the healthy therapeutic lifestyle changes diet.

Detailed description

The main objective of the study is to identify the effect of pulses on a range of PCOS and metabolic syndrome features. In this parallel clinical trial, 110 (18-35 years old) women with PCOS will be recruited. Participants will be randomly assigned to either a pulse-based diet or a therapeutic lifestyle changes-based diet. The effect of a pulse-based diet on a range of reproductive and metabolic parameters will be evaluated. The results of this study are anticipated to evaluate the therapeutic merits of a pulse-based diet for women with PCOS which would influence dietary guidelines.

Interventions

DIETARY_SUPPLEMENTPulse-based diet

An isocaloric, balanced diet with a fixed macronutrient composition of 28% fat, 55% carbohydrate, and 17% protein. The pulse diet will include two pulse-based meals; each pulse meal will be consisted of about one cup of non-oil seed pulses, different varieties of pulses (dried beans, peas, lentils, lupine and chickpeas) will be used.

DIETARY_SUPPLEMENTTLC diet

An isocaloric, balanced diet with a fixed macronutrient composition of 28% fat, 55% carbohydrate, and 17% protein. The healthy TLC diet will be tailored for each participant according to their energy levels in order to achieve the following amount of nutrients: less than 7% of total calories of saturated fatty acids, up to 10% of total calories of polyunsaturated fat, up to 20% of total calories of monounsaturated fat, less than 200 mg a day of cholesterol, at least 5 to 10 grams a day of soluble fiber.

Inclusion criteria

* Female * Diagnosis of PCOS in addition to insulin resistance (Homeostasis model assessment (HOMA)-insulin resistance index ≥ 2). * Aged 18-35 years

Exclusion criteria

* Individuals that are Keto diet, vegetarian, pregnant, lactating, class 2 obese (body mass index (BMI) ≥35) current smoker, or if they have diabetes, cardiovascular, kidney, liver, or hormonal disease. * Individuals taking any medication or supplementation known to affect lipid, glucose, or hormone levels, and/or body weight for at least the last 3 months. * Any individual who has an allergy or intolerance to pulses.
